Scholarship Applications Now Open

We’re excited to announce that applications for the 2026 Rotary Club of Andover Scholarships are now being accepted! The Club proudly offers these scholarships to graduating high school seniors who live in Andover and plan to pursue higher education. This long-standing program honors the memory of Philip Mercandetti, Barbara Doran, and other community supporters and reflects our commitment to helping local students achieve their educational goals.

Eligible students must live in Andover, not be a direct relative of a Rotarian, and be planning to attend a college or post-secondary program next semester. Scholarships of up to $3,000 will be awarded based on academic performance, community service, financial need, and future goals.

Important: The application deadline is April 2, 2026.

Rotary Supports Kiwanis “Bike Rodeo for Kids”

We’re pleased to help promote an upcoming community event hosted by the Kiwanis Club of Greater Lawrence — the Kiwanis Bike Rodeo for Kids! This fun, hands-on event teaches children important bicycle safety skills while building confidence and encouraging healthy outdoor activity. Kids will navigate a safe riding obstacle course and learn key rules of the road and helmet safety from trained volunteers.

The Bike Rodeo is set for April 18, 2026 at Lawrence Veterans Memorial Stadium, in partnership with the Merrimack Valley YMCA’s Healthy Kids Day. More than 1,000 children from Lawrence and surrounding communities are expected to attend.

In addition to safety education, the event aims to provide new and refurbished bikes, helmets, and on-site repairs for children who need them — helping remove barriers so every child can ride safely.
